What Is a No Filter Air Purifier, and How Does It Differ from Traditional Models?
A no filter air purifier is a type of air purification system that utilizes advanced technologies to clean the air without the need for traditional replaceable filters. Instead of relying on physical filters to trap particles, these devices often use methods such as ultraviolet (UV) light, ionization, or photocatalytic oxidation to eliminate pollutants, allergens, and microorganisms from the air.
According to the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A), air purifiers can significantly reduce airborne contaminants, thus improving indoor air quality (IAQ) (EPA, 2021). Traditional air purifiers typically use HEPA filters to capture particles, which can require regular maintenance and replacement, adding cost and effort for the user. In contrast, no filter air purifiers are designed for convenience and efficiency, eliminating the need for ongoing filter replacements.
Key aspects of no filter air purifiers include their maintenance-free operation and often lower long-term costs. Many models are equipped with technologies that can neutralize odors and kill bacteria and viruses, making them ideal for households with pets, allergies, or respiratory issues. These devices can also be energy-efficient, as they typically consume less electricity compared to traditional purifiers that require fans to push air through filters. Furthermore, without filters that can become clogged over time, no filter purifiers may maintain consistent performance over their lifespan.

How Does a No Filter Air Purifier Work to Clean the Air?
UV-C Light: Ultraviolet light technology works by emitting UV-C light waves that are capable of destroying the DNA and RNA of bacteria and viruses. This method is particularly effective in killing airborne pathogens, making the air safer to breathe, especially in environments where germs are a concern.
Ozone Generation: Ozone generators produce ozone, a gas that can oxidize and neutralize pollutants and odors in the air. While effective at eliminating certain odors and harmful substances, caution is advised since high concentrations of ozone can be harmful to human health when inhaled.
Photocatalytic Oxidation: This technology utilizes a light-activated catalyst, typically titanium dioxide, which, when illuminated, creates a reaction that breaks down harmful air pollutants into harmless substances like carbon dioxide and water. It is a powerful method that operates silently and without the need for filters.
Electrostatic Precipitation: This system works by charging airborne particles and collecting them on oppositely charged plates. The collected particles can be easily cleaned from the plates, which eliminates the need for filter replacements and ensures continuous air purification without the recurring costs associated with traditional filters.

What Features Should Be Considered When Choosing a No Filter Air Purifier?
When selecting the best no filter air purifier, several key features should be considered to ensure effective air cleaning and optimal performance.
- Technology Type: Different no filter air purifiers utilize various technologies such as ionizers, UV-C light, and ozone generation. Understanding how each technology works will help determine its effectiveness in removing pollutants and allergens from the air.
- Airflow Rate: The airflow rate, measured in cubic feet per minute (CFM), indicates how much air the purifier can process. A higher airflow rate typically means faster purification of larger spaces, making it essential to choose a model suited to the size of the intended room.
- Noise Level: The noise level of an air purifier can significantly impact your comfort, especially if it will be used in a bedroom or quiet space. Look for models with adjustable settings or low decibel ratings to ensure it operates quietly while maintaining air quality.
- Energy Efficiency: Energy-efficient models help reduce electricity bills while maintaining performance. Check for Energy Star ratings or other certifications that indicate the purifier’s energy consumption and efficiency.
- Maintenance Requirements: Although no filter purifiers require less maintenance than traditional models, some still need periodic cleaning or replacement of parts. Consider how easy it is to maintain the unit and whether replacement components are readily available.
- Portability: If you plan to move the purifier between rooms or take it on the go, portability features such as lightweight design and built-in handles can be beneficial. This flexibility allows for better air quality wherever you need it.
- Additional Features: Many modern air purifiers come with extra features such as air quality indicators, smart home compatibility, and programmable timers. These features can enhance usability and provide real-time feedback on air quality, making it easier to manage indoor air cleanliness.
